Does the iPhone Have a Real Long Exposure Mode?
The standard iPhone Camera app does not include a dedicated button labeled Long Exposure or the kind of bulb mode photographers use on interchangeable-lens cameras. Instead, Apple’s easiest built-in solution begins with Live Photos. A Live Photo records movement around the moment you press the shutter. After taking it, you can open the image in Photos and choose Long Exposure from the Live Photo effects. Apple describes the result as an effect that simulates a DSLR-like long exposure. That distinction matters.
With a conventional camera, you might deliberately keep the shutter open for several seconds. With Apple’s built-in approach, the phone uses captured Live Photo information to create a similar visual treatment. This makes the feature extremely convenient, but it also means it has limitations compared with specialized long-exposure apps.
How to Take a Long Exposure iPhone Photo With Live Photos
The Live Photo method is the best place to start because it requires no additional app, subscription, or photography experience. Apple’s current instructions confirm that Live Photos can be enabled in Photo mode and that a captured Live Photo can later be changed to Long Exposure in Photos.
Follow these steps.
- Open the Camera app.
- Make sure you are using Photo mode.
- Turn Live Photo on.
- Compose your scene.
- Keep the iPhone as steady as possible.
- Press the shutter without moving the phone.
- Open the image in the Photos app.
- Tap Live near the top of the photo.
- Select Long Exposure.
- Give Photos a moment to render the result.
You can return to the Live Photo controls later and change the effect again, so applying Long Exposure does not mean you must permanently commit to that appearance.

Hold the Phone Still Before and After the Shutter
Stability matters more than many beginners expect. Your goal is usually to blur the moving subject while keeping buildings, rocks, bridges, signs, or the landscape sharp. If your iPhone moves during capture, stationary objects can blur too.
For the cleanest result:
- hold the phone with both hands,
- brace your elbows against your body,
- lean against a wall or railing when possible,
- place the phone on a stable surface,
- or use a tripod.
A stable frame gives the software a much cleaner foundation from which to produce the motion effect.
Best Subjects for iPhone Long Exposure Photography
Not every moving subject benefits equally from this technique. The strongest compositions normally combine something that moves with something that stays still.
Waterfalls, Rivers, and Fountains
Flowing water is one of the easiest subjects to practice on. A stable rock, bridge, tree, or riverbank gives the photograph visual structure while the water becomes smoother and softer. Small waterfalls and fountains can work particularly well with the built-in Live Photo technique because their motion is continuous.
Moving Traffic and Headlights
Traffic creates a different look. At night, moving headlights and taillights can become streaks of light when you use an app designed for longer captures or light trails.
Look for:
- curved roads,
- bridges,
- elevated viewpoints,
- intersections,
- tunnels,
- or streets with a strong stationary foreground.
Keep yourself safely away from active traffic while composing the shot.
Crowds and Moving People
Long-exposure techniques can make moving people appear blurred, translucent, or less prominent while architecture stays relatively sharp. This can be useful around landmarks and busy public spaces. Computational long-exposure apps such as Spectre specifically promote the ability to reduce or remove moving crowds by blending multiple images.
Clouds
Cloud movement can add direction and drama to landscapes. The built-in effect may produce a subtle change when clouds are moving quickly. More extended app-based capture is generally better when you want visibly stretched cloud movement.
Fireworks and Light Painting
These scenes depend on moving light rather than merely moving objects. Apps offering dedicated light-trail capture are better suited to this style than the basic Live Photo conversion. NightCap, for example, currently includes a Light Trails mode intended for subjects such as traffic, fireworks, and light painting.
Live Photo vs Long Exposure Camera Apps
The best method depends on the result you want.
| Method | Best Use | Control Level | Tripod |
| Live Photo + Photos | Water, fountains, simple motion effects | Basic | Helpful |
| Spectre Camera | Computational long exposures, crowds, water, light trails | Moderate | Helpful but not always essential |
| Slow Shutter Cam | Slow-shutter-style creative effects | More manual | Recommended for many scenes |
| NightCap Camera | Long exposure, light trails and astrophotography | Advanced | Useful, although current versions also support handheld processing |
Apple’s method is free and easy. Third-party apps become more useful when you want longer capture periods, dedicated light trails, astrophotography features, or greater creative control.
Best Apps for More Long Exposure Control
App pricing and functionality can change, so always check the current App Store listing before purchasing anything.
Spectre Camera
Specter is developed by Lux Optics, the company behind Halide. It builds long exposures computationally by blending many frames. Its current App Store listing describes features for waterfalls, moving crowds, city light trails, and other motion-based effects. The developer’s version history states that Specter supports long exposures of up to 30 seconds.
It is currently listed as free with an optional in-app Spectre Pro purchase. That makes Spectre particularly attractive when you want an approachable step up from Apple’s Live Photo effect.

Slow Shutter Cam
Slow Shutter Cam focuses specifically on slow-shutter-style photography. Its current App Store listing describes it as an application for producing creative slow shutter effects on iPhone and iPad. It may suit photographers who want a dedicated interface rather than simply converting an existing Live Photo.
NightCap Camera
NightCap is oriented toward long exposure, low-light photography, light trails, and astrophotography. Its current version includes modes for star trails, meteors, stars, long exposure, light trails, and aurora time-lapse photography.
The developer also states that its newer processing can align frames for handheld long exposures, so the older advice that a tripod is always mandatory for the app is no longer accurate. For extremely demanding subjects such as star trails, however, physically stabilizing your phone remains a sensible choice.
7 Powerful Long Exposure iPhone Tips to Avoid Bad Blur
The effect itself is easy to activate. Producing a photograph that looks intentional requires more thought.
1. Stabilize the Stationary Parts of Your Scene
Before concentrating on moving water or headlights, identify what must remain sharp. A bridge, building, rock, tree, railing, or horizon can act as the visual anchor. If that anchor moves because of camera shake, the photograph tends to look like a mistake instead of an intentional long exposure.
2. Use a Timer or Remote Release
Touching the screen can introduce a small movement at the moment of capture. If your chosen camera app supports a self-timer, use it when the phone is mounted. An Apple Watch can also function as a camera remote for Apple’s Camera app on supported setups.
3. Look for Motion That Has a Clear Direction
Long exposure works best when movement contributes to the composition.
Examples include:
- water flowing diagonally through the frame,
- cars following a curved road,
- clouds moving toward a mountain,
- commuters crossing a fixed architectural scene.
Random motion can simply look messy.
4. Shoot More Than One Version
Small differences in timing can produce very different results. Take several photographs rather than trusting the first attempt. Cars may enter the frame differently, waves may change shape, and crowds may briefly create unwanted gaps.
5. Experiment Around Dusk
Dusk is especially useful for light trails and city scenes because there may still be enough ambient light to preserve buildings and sky detail while vehicle lights become visually prominent. It can be easier to balance than the middle of a bright day or a completely dark night.
6. Consider an ND Filter for Bright Conditions
A neutral-density filter reduces the amount of light reaching the camera. That can be useful when using a camera app that allows longer capture techniques during daylight. Without reducing incoming light, maintaining a long capture in very bright conditions can be difficult. An ND filter is most useful once you have moved beyond the basic Live Photo method and want greater control over daylight motion blur.

7. Compose the Photograph Before Thinking About the Effect
A long exposure cannot rescue a weak composition.
Use the same fundamentals you would use for an ordinary photograph:
- simplify distracting backgrounds,
- keep horizons intentional,
- identify a clear subject,
- consider foreground interest,
- watch bright highlights,
- and decide where the viewer’s eye should travel.
The blur should support the image rather than become the entire reason the image exists.
Why Your Long Exposure Photo Looks Wrong
Many failed images come from a few predictable problems.
Everything Is Blurry
If rocks, buildings, signs, and other stationary objects are also soft, the iPhone probably moved during capture. Use a tripod, firm surface, timer, or steadier grip and try again.
The Effect Is Barely Visible
The subject may not have moved enough. Try faster-moving water, traffic, a busier scene, or a dedicated long-exposure app that can capture motion over a longer period.
Moving Objects Look Broken or Ghosted
Computational blending does not always create perfectly continuous motion. Irregular subjects-especially people changing direction-may produce fragments or ghosting. Try another capture when the movement is more consistent.
Long Exposure Does Not Appear in Photos
Make sure the image was actually captured as a Live Photo. Apple’s Long Exposure effect is selected from the effects available for Live Photos, so an ordinary still photograph will not provide the same built-in conversion workflow.
Light Trails Are Too Weak
The built-in Live Photo method may simply be too limited for the result you want. A dedicated application with light-trail functionality is a better choice for extended traffic trails, fireworks, light painting, or similar subjects.
When Should You Use Apple’s Free Method?
Choose the built-in long exposure iPhone workflow when:
- you are learning the technique,
- you do not want another app,
- you are photographing moving water,
- you only need a subtle motion effect,
- or you want something quick enough for casual photography.
Choose a specialized app when:
- you want stronger light trails,
- you need an extended capture,
- you are attempting star trails or astrophotography,
- you want computational crowd removal,
- or you need more creative control.
Neither approach is automatically better. They solve different photographic problems.
Frequently Asked Questions
Can an iPhone take long exposure photos?
Yes. The simplest built-in approach is to capture a Live Photo and choose Long Exposure in the Photos app. Apple describes the effect as simulating a DSLR-like long exposure. Dedicated apps provide additional options.
Where is the Long Exposure setting on the iPhone?
It is not a normal shooting mode in the Camera app. First capture a Live Photo, open it in Photos, tap the Live Photo control, and choose Long Exposure.
Do I need an app for long exposure iPhone photography?
No. You can start with Apple’s Live Photo effect without installing another app. An app becomes useful when you need longer or more specialized captures.
Do I need a tripod?
Not always, but stabilization usually improves the image. It is especially helpful when you need stationary objects to stay sharp or when using extended capture techniques.
Can an iPhone photograph light trails?
Yes. The Live Photo effect can create some motion blur, but dedicated apps with specific light-trail modes offer more control for moving headlights, fireworks, and light painting.
Can I photograph waterfalls with an iPhone?
Yes. Waterfalls are one of the easiest subjects for iPhone long exposure photography because the moving water contrasts clearly with stationary rocks and scenery.
Can I create star trails with an iPhone?
Specialized apps can support star-trail photography. NightCap currently includes a dedicated Star Trails mode along with other astrophotography options.
Why can’t I find Long Exposure on one of my photos?
The built-in effect works with Live Photos. If you captured a normal still photograph with Live Photo disabled, that effect will not appear through the same Live Photo controls.
Is Spectre still useful for iPhone long exposures?
Yes. Spectre’s current App Store listing continues to focus on computational long-exposure photography, and its version history states that captures of up to 30 seconds are supported.
What is the easiest way for a beginner to start?
Start with Live Photos. Photograph flowing water while keeping the phone stable, convert the shot to Long Exposure in Photos, and compare several attempts. Once you understand how motion affects the final image, experiment with dedicated apps.
